The Old Town is located in the center of Bucharest, Romania, and is known for its nightlife. [1] Ion C. Brătianu Boulevard crosses the historic center from north to south, dividing this area into two approximately equal parts. Also in this perimeter is the beginning of the Calea Moșilor.

4 lists. Building. The Old Princely Court (Curtea Veche) was the main residence of Wallachian princes, and is best known for being the home of Vlad Tepes, otherwise known as Dracula. The building still stands in part, including walls, arches, and columns. Str. Franceză 23, București 030167, Romania.

Mediaș The medieval centre of the ancient settlement of Medias has a particular charm, with narrow winding lanes, centuries-old houses and a large pedestrian square. The fortified St. Margaret Evangelical Church, erected in the 15th century on the ruins of a Roman basilica, dominates the old town.

Much of Bucharest and Romania's rich history is visible in the city's old town. Due to the big fire, most of the old town of Bucharest only dates back to the mid-19th century. Just a few of the buildings around dates back to the 17th and 18th century. a couple being the Wallachian Princes-court, the church next to it and the in on the other.
